2. Direct observation of biomolecule adsorption and spatial distribution of functional groups in chromatographic adsorbent particles
Abstract : Confocal microscopy has been used as a tool for studying adsorption of biomolecules to individual chromatographic adsorbent particles. By coupling a fluorescent dye to protein molecules, their penetration into single adsorbent particles could be observed visually at different times during batch uptake. READ MORE

5. Crystallization of Parabens : Thermodynamics, Nucleation and Processing
Abstract : In this work, the solubility of butyl paraben in 7 pure solvents and in 5 different ethanol-water mixtures has been determined from 1 ˚C to 50 ˚C. The solubility of ethyl paraben and propyl paraben in various solvents has been determined at 10 ˚C. READ MORE
